Ingredients
- Potatoes: 1.2 kg peeled and thinly sliced
- Onion: 1 large, thinly sliced
- Whole milk: 200 ml
- Heavy cream: 150 ml
- Cheddar cheese: 120 g grated
- Unsalted butter: 30 g plus extra for greasing
- Garlic: 2 cloves minced
- Salt: 1 tsp
- Black pepper: 1/2 tsp
- Ground nutmeg: 1/4 tsp optional
- Fresh parsley: 2 tbsp chopped for garnish

Instructions
- Step 1:
- Preheat the oven to 190°C (375°F). Grease a medium baking dish with butter.
- Step 2:
- In a small saucepan mel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.
- Step 3:
- Stir in the milk cream salt pepper and nutmeg if using. Heat gently until just warmed do not boil. Remove from heat.
- Step 4:
- Layer half the potato slices in the prepared baking dish. Top with half of the sliced onions and half of the cheese.
- Step 5:
- Repeat the layers with the remaining potatoes onions and cheese.
- Step 6:
- Pour the warm milk and cream mixture evenly over the layers.
- Step 7:
- Cover the dish tightly with foil and bake for 40 minutes.
- Step 8:
- Remove the foil and bake for an additional 20 minutes or until the top is golden brown and the potatoes are tender.
- Step 9:
- Let rest for 5 minutes before serving. Garnish with chopped parsley if desired.

Notes
Serve as a main course with a green salad or as a hearty side dish.
Required Tools
Sharp knife cutting board saucepan baking dish approx 22x28 cm 9x11 in aluminum foil
Nutritional Information
Calories 370 Total Fat 17 g Carbohydrates 44 g Protein 10 g per serving

Recipe FAQs
- → What type of potatoes work best for this bake?
Firm, waxy potatoes are ideal as they hold their shape well during baking, ensuring nice layers without becoming mushy.
- → Can I substitute the cheddar cheese with another variety?
Yes, Gruyère or mozzarella provide excellent alternatives, each bringing a unique melt and flavor to the dish.
- → How can I add extra flavor to the bake?
Layering in sliced tomatoes or cooked bacon adds depth and richness to the casserole, enhancing overall taste.
- → Is it necessary to cover the dish during baking?
Covering with foil allows the potatoes to steam and cook evenly before uncovering to brown the top and create a golden crust.
- → What is the best way to serve this potato layer bake?
It pairs nicely as a main course with a fresh green salad or as a hearty side alongside roasted or grilled vegetables.
